What is national flower of UK?

The national flower of the UK is the rose, specifically the Tudor rose, which symbolizes the union of the Houses of Lancaster and York. It is often associated with England and represents love and beauty. In addition to the rose, Scotland has the thistle, Wales has the daffodil, and Northern Ireland has the flax flower, each representing their respective nations within the UK.

What is a national flower?

A national flower is a flower chosen to be a symbol of a country. As an example, the Rose was selected as the national flower of the United States in 1985.According to an Internet search, the Rose is also the national flower ofUnited Kingdom (Tudor Rose)BulgariaCyprusCzech RepublicEcuadorIran (specifically a red rose)IraqLuxembourgMaldives (specifically pink)SlovakiaMany countries have not chosen a national flower.
